Output 67d8d6c52114f0ea4cc29739d4b84e50c793a051917daabfbb4f117bb55b0441:1

value
1770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f176463586c40cf683280827df9afeb0e231b2 OP_EQUAL
address
3HTTQcWerok6E8BKXgpcvG2y9NhGpkzeGp
transaction
67d8d6c52114f0ea4cc29739d4b84e50c793a051917daabfbb4f117bb55b0441
confirmations
417350
spent
true